如何在 React 中使用型別檢查(type checking)?

React 是一個用於構建用戶界面的 JavaScript 函式庫,它可以讓開發者更輕鬆地構建高品質的用戶界面。在 React 中,型別檢查是一種重要的技術,可以幫助開發者更好地管理和控制程式碼。本文將介紹如何在 React 中使用型別檢查。

React 使用 Flow 作為其型別檢查系統。Flow 是一個基於 JavaScript 的型別檢查系統,可以幫助開發者更好地管理和控制程式碼。Flow 可以檢查程式碼中的錯誤,並提供更多的型別安全性。

要在 React 中使用 Flow,首先需要安裝 Flow:

npm install --save-dev flow-bin

接下來,需要在 React 項目的根目錄中創建一個 .flowconfig 文件,並將以下內容添加到文件中:

[ignore]
.*/node_modules/.*

[include]

[libs]

[options]
esproposal.class_static_fields=enable
esproposal.class_instance_fields=enable

接下來,需要在 React 項目的 package.json 文件中添加一個 script:

"scripts": {
  "flow": "flow"
}

最後,可以使用以下命令啟動 Flow:

npm run flow

Flow 會在 React 項目中檢查程式碼,並提供型別安全性。此外,Flow 還可以檢查程式碼中的錯誤,並提供更多的型別安全性。

總結,React 中使用型別檢查可以幫助開發者更好地管理和控制程式碼。Flow 是 React 中使用的型別檢查系統,可以檢查程式碼中的錯誤,並提供更多的型別安全性。

Categorized in:

Tagged in:

,